Question #37185335
5:10pm, Thursday 18 Nov 2010
Home Phone activated yesterday, 17 Nov, and my next billing date is 10 Dec.
Service Notices, and the emails received today, confirm that I am being correctly billed pro rata -
Rental £8.63 + Call Plan £3.83 = Total £12.46
However, my Itemised Bill (attached) is showing -
Rental £8.63 + Call Plan £5 = Total £13.63
Please amend the Itemised Bill to show the correct amount.
Answer
7:13am, Sunday 21 Nov 2010
Thank you for your query. The price for your call plan displayed on the Itemised bill is for a full month this is correct however the amount we will be invoicing you for will be the pro amount of £3.83.
How can it be correct to show one item as pro rata and the other for the whole month? Surely a 'Payment Summary' should be, er, a summary of what I pay?

This appears to be a more general problem.
I have migrated mine plus four of my referral accounts to Talk Anytime this month and this anomaly appears on all of them.
The problem appears to be that the CALL PLAN Charge in the Home Phone/ Itemised Bill Tab is not being Pro-Rated.

It would appear likely, then, to be a billing system bug.
It's no big deal in reality, as I realised that the amount being invoiced was correct. I raised a ticket to point out the error, as there's no point in having a payment summary within itemised billing if it's not accurate.
If the ticket reply had acknowledged the error, that would have been acceptable. What is not acceptable is being told that the itemised bill is correct when patently it is not - hence my bringing it to the forum.
